This service is crucial because gluten-free food is essential for individuals with conditions such as coeliac disease, non-coeliac gluten sensitivity, and wheat allergies. Addressing these dietary needs is crucial, as untreated gluten-related disorders can lead to serious health problems such as malnutrition, osteoporosis, infertility, and even cancer

Coeliac disease affects approximately 1 in 100 people worldwide, yet many remain undiagnosed. In the UK alone, it’s estimated that nearly two-thirds of those with coeliac disease have not been medically diagnosed, potentially affecting 500,000 people nationwide, including over 30,000 in Scotland.
